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
380403947 3833706 17733345 707
50604300720 3391677
50604300720 3391677
7044536 69142514924 055930 850944
All about undefined
Interested in learning more?
50604300720 3391677
7044536 69142514924 055930 850944
See more
678905 44001 021094459
569837142 707564 132 78
See more
812 7726912772 5275
25407 537870599 25
See more